Abstract:
The present invention relates to phenol containing disinfectants that have superior broad-spectrum antimicrobial efficacy versus traditional chemistry such as quaternary ammonium-containing disinfectants or aliphatic alcohols. Hydrotropic surfactants are utilized in combination with generally environmentally friendly phenol containing compounds such as ortho-benzyl parachlorophenol (OBPCP), ortho phenylphenol (OPP), or parachloro-meta-cresol (PCMC) in the presence of suitable solvents such as an aliphatic alcohol and also in the presence of an inorganic acid, such as phosphoric acid. The solutions are free of para tertiary amylphenol (PTAP), have a low pH and are very stable with respect to gamma irradiation. They can be used with respect to hard surface disinfection, and also as a tuberculocide, a fungicide, a bactericide, and a virucide.
